A typical telephone contact sequence within Canada consists of ten digits structured into three distinct parts. The initial three digits represent the area code, identifying a specific geographic region within the country. This is followed by a three-digit exchange code, sometimes referred to as the central office code, which further narrows down the location. Finally, a four-digit subscriber number uniquely identifies the individual phone line within that exchange. For instance, a valid sequence might appear as 613-555-0100.

  • Area Code Identification

    The first three digits of the ten-digit sequence constitute the area code. This component geographically identifies the region where the phone number is assigned. For example, area code 416 primarily serves the city of Toronto, while 604 designates much of the Lower Mainland in British Columbia. The area code is critical for directing calls to the correct local exchange carrier and facilitating regional services.

  • Exchange Code (Central Office Code)

    Following the area code, the next three digits represent the exchange code, also known as the central office code. This further narrows down the geographic location to a specific exchange within the area code region. The exchange code, in conjunction with the area code, allows the telecommunications infrastructure to pinpoint the precise local switching office responsible for managing the phone line.

  • Subscriber Number Uniqueness

    The final four digits form the subscriber number, uniquely identifying the individual phone line within the designated exchange. This segment distinguishes each phone line from all others within the same area code and exchange code combination, ensuring that calls reach the correct recipient. For instance, within the 416 area code and a specific exchange code, each of the 10,000 possible subscriber numbers represents a distinct connection point.

  • North American Numbering Plan (NANP) Compliance

    The ten-digit sequence conforms to the North American Numbering Plan (NANP), which governs phone number allocation and management across Canada, the United States, and several Caribbean nations. This adherence ensures interoperability between telecommunications systems in these regions, enabling seamless cross-border calling and standardized dialing procedures. The NANP dictates the structure and rules for assigning area codes and exchange codes, maintaining a consistent numbering framework.

  • Geographic Boundaries

    Area codes define specific geographic regions, varying in size from entire provinces to portions of major metropolitan areas. These boundaries are not determined by political divisions but instead by population density and telecommunication infrastructure capacity. For example, a densely populated urban center might have multiple area codes to accommodate the large volume of phone lines, whereas a sparsely populated region might be covered by a single area code. The geographic area covered by each code plays a vital role in the assignment and utilization of phone numbers.

  • Population Density Impact

    Population density significantly influences the allocation of area codes. Densely populated areas often require additional codes as the existing numbering resources become exhausted. This necessitates the creation of new area codes, either through geographic splits, where the original area is divided, or overlays, where a new code is introduced within the same geographic region. These processes are implemented to ensure an adequate supply of phone numbers for residents and businesses in the affected areas.

  • Service Area Overlap

    The introduction of new area codes within existing geographic regions, known as area code overlays, can lead to mandatory ten-digit dialing. This requirement ensures that the correct call routing occurs even when multiple area codes serve the same location. Such scenarios necessitate a clear understanding of the geographical area associated with each code and its implications for dialing protocols.

  • Switching Functionality

    The central office functions as a switching center, directing calls from one phone line to another. Within a given area code, multiple central offices exist, each assigned a unique three-digit exchange code. This code allows the telecommunications network to identify the specific switching equipment responsible for handling a particular phone line. For instance, if a phone number is 613-555-0100, the “555” portion designates a particular central office within the 613 area code. This functionality is essential for ensuring accurate call delivery.

  • Number Allocation and Assignment

    The assignment of exchange codes is managed by regulatory bodies and telecommunications providers. Each exchange code represents a block of 10,000 potential phone numbers (from 0000 to 9999). When a service provider requires a new block of numbers for a particular area, it requests an available exchange code. This systematic allocation prevents number exhaustion and ensures efficient resource management. The availability of exchange codes influences the expansion and service capacity of telecommunications networks.

  • Geographic Specificity within Area Code

    While the area code identifies a broad geographic region, the exchange code offers greater specificity. Adjacent areas within the same area code may be served by different central offices with distinct exchange codes. This geographic specificity impacts local calling areas and the determination of long-distance charges. Knowing the exchange code allows telecommunication companies to determine the most efficient route for a call and apply appropriate billing rates. The exchange code is a key factor in local call routing optimization.

  • Evolution and Technological Advancements

    Historically, central offices were physical locations housing electromechanical switching equipment. Modern telecommunications networks, however, utilize digital switching technology and virtualized central offices. Despite these technological advancements, the fundamental function of the exchange code remains the same: to identify the switching entity responsible for a specific range of phone numbers.   • Unique Endpoint Designation

    The four-digit subscriber number, ranging from 0000 to 9999, provides 10,000 possible unique identifiers within each exchange. This uniqueness is essential for directing incoming calls to the correct endpoint, whether it is a landline, mobile phone, or VoIP device. Incorrect subscriber identification would result in misdirected calls and service disruptions. A practical example is a business with multiple phone lines in the same exchange, each requiring a distinct subscriber number to ensure proper routing.

  • Database Association and Billing

    The subscriber number is directly associated with a specific customer account in the telecommunications provider’s database. This association enables accurate billing, service management, and customer support. The provider’s system uses the entire ten-digit number, including the subscriber portion, to identify the account and apply charges for calls, data usage, and other services. For instance, a subscriber’s long-distance charges are tracked and applied to the account associated with their unique phone number.

  • Emergency Services and Location Tracking

    In emergency situations, the subscriber number is critical for identifying the caller’s location. When a call is placed to emergency services (e.g., 9-1-1), the phone number, including the subscriber digits, is used to access location information associated with that line. This information allows emergency responders to dispatch assistance to the correct address. Accurate subscriber identification is, therefore, vital for public safety and effective emergency response. Without accurate subscriber data, emergency services may be misdirected, potentially delaying critical assistance.

  • Number Portability Implications

    Number portability allows subscribers to retain their phone number when changing service providers or moving to a new location within the same rate center. The subscriber number, in conjunction with the area code and exchange, remains constant, while the associated service provider and network routing information are updated. This feature relies on accurate and consistent subscriber identification to ensure seamless service transition. Incorrect or outdated subscriber data can lead to porting delays or service disruptions. Porting a number maintains the subscriber identification, decoupling it from specific hardware or service providers.

7. Regulatory oversight (CRTC)

The Canadian Radio-television and Telecommunications Commission (CRTC) exercises comprehensive regulatory oversight over the telecommunications sector in Canada. This oversight extends directly to the allocation, assignment, and management of Canadian phone numbers, ensuring equitable access, efficient utilization, and adherence to established standards. The CRTC’s role is critical in maintaining the integrity and functionality of the Canadian numbering system, impacting every telephone contact sequence within the country.

  • Numbering Resource Allocation

    The CRTC establishes policies and guidelines for the allocation of numbering resources, including area codes and exchange codes, to telecommunications service providers. It assesses the need for new area codes based on population growth and number utilization rates, preventing number exhaustion and ensuring sufficient capacity for future demands. Decisions regarding geographic splits versus overlays for new area codes are made under CRTC guidelines, impacting dialing patterns and network configurations. An example includes the introduction of overlay area codes in major metropolitan areas to address increasing phone number demands. The CRTCs allocation policies directly affect the availability and structure of Canadian phone numbers.

  • Number Portability Enforcement

    The CRTC mandates and enforces local number portability (LNP), enabling subscribers to retain their phone numbers when switching service providers. This regulatory requirement promotes competition among telecommunications companies and empowers consumers with greater choice. The CRTC sets the rules and procedures for porting numbers, ensuring a seamless transition and preventing anti-competitive practices. Penalties for non-compliance with LNP regulations can be substantial, highlighting the importance of adhering to CRTC directives. Enforcement of number portability ensures that an established Canadian phone number remains viable regardless of the subscriber’s choice of service provider.

  • Consumer Protection and Fraud Prevention

    The CRTC implements measures to protect consumers from fraudulent telemarketing calls and other unwanted communications. These measures include regulations regarding caller ID spoofing and the establishment of a National Do Not Call List (DNCL). The CRTC investigates complaints related to unauthorized use of phone numbers and takes enforcement action against violators. By regulating telemarketing practices, the CRTC indirectly safeguards the integrity of Canadian phone numbers, ensuring they are not misused for illicit purposes. Consumer protection initiatives enhance the value and trustworthiness associated with a Canadian phone number.

  • Emergency Services Access

    The CRTC ensures that all Canadians have access to reliable emergency services through 9-1-1. This includes requiring telecommunications providers to accurately route emergency calls to the appropriate Public Safety Answering Point (PSAP) and to provide accurate location information. The CRTC also mandates that VoIP providers offer 9-1-1 service, addressing challenges related to location determination for nomadic VoIP users. Compliance with CRTC regulations regarding 9-1-1 is critical for public safety and ensures that every Canadian phone number can be used to access emergency assistance. The reliability of 9-1-1 service is directly linked to CRTC oversight of telecommunications infrastructure and service provision.

  • Caller ID Spoofing

    Caller ID spoofing involves manipulating the information displayed on the recipient’s caller ID to disguise the originating phone number. Fraudsters often spoof legitimate Canadian phone numbers to create the illusion of trustworthiness, increasing the likelihood that the recipient will answer the call and engage with the scam. This tactic undermines the reliability of caller ID as a means of verifying the caller’s identity. For example, a fraudster might spoof a government agency’s phone number to solicit personal information or demand payment, exploiting the recipient’s trust in official institutions.

  • Robocall Scams

    Robocalls, pre-recorded messages delivered automatically to numerous phone numbers, are frequently used to perpetrate scams. Fraudsters employ robocalls to promote deceptive offers, solicit personal data, or threaten legal action. While not all robocalls are fraudulent, a significant proportion involves illegal or unethical practices. A common example involves robocalls impersonating tax authorities, demanding immediate payment to avoid arrest. The perceived legitimacy of the displayed Canadian phone number can lull recipients into a false sense of security.

  • Phishing and Vishing

    Phishing, the practice of attempting to acquire sensitive information (e.g., usernames, passwords, credit card details) by disguising oneself as a trustworthy entity, extends to telephone communications through “vishing” (voice phishing). Fraudsters use phone calls to impersonate banks, credit card companies, or other reputable organizations, requesting personal information under false pretenses. The use of a spoofed Canadian phone number can enhance the credibility of the vishing attempt. For instance, a fraudster might call pretending to be a bank representative, claiming suspicious activity on the recipient’s account and requesting verification of their credentials.

  • Premium Rate Scams

    Premium rate scams involve enticing individuals to call phone numbers that charge exorbitant per-minute fees. These scams often utilize deceptive advertisements or misleading messages to lure unsuspecting victims. A fraudster might advertise a free prize or offer technical support, only to direct callers to a premium rate number where they are kept on hold for extended periods, incurring substantial charges. The initial contact might appear to originate from a standard Canadian phone number, concealing the true nature of the premium rate service.

  • Country Code Inclusion

    When dialing a Canadian phone number from abroad, the country code (+1) must precede the ten-digit sequence. Failure to include the correct country code will result in call failure. For example, to reach the Canadian number 613-555-0100 from outside North America, the complete dialing sequence would be +1-613-555-0100. The absence of the country code misdirects the call to the local numbering plan of the originating country, rendering the Canadian number unrecognizable. The correct prefix ensures that the call is correctly routed to the North American Numbering Plan area.

  • International Call Routing and Termination

    International calls involve complex routing through multiple telecommunications networks, both in the originating and terminating countries. These networks establish agreements for call termination, which determine the cost structures associated with international calls. The cost of calling a Canadian phone number from abroad varies significantly depending on the originating country and the service provider used. Termination charges, levied by the Canadian service provider to the foreign carrier, contribute to the overall cost. These charges often reflect the infrastructure costs and regulatory fees within Canada.

  • Reverse Charge and Collect Calls

    Reverse charge or collect calls, where the recipient agrees to pay for the call, are subject to international agreements and service availability. Not all countries support collect calls to Canadian phone numbers, and the associated charges can be significantly higher than standard international rates. The availability and cost of collect calls depend on the agreements between the telecommunications providers in the originating and terminating countries. Subscribers attempting to place collect calls to Canada from certain regions may encounter limitations or prohibitive charges.

  • Emergency Services Limitations

    Access to emergency services (e.g., 9-1-1) may be limited or unavailable when dialing a Canadian phone number from abroad using certain telecommunications services, particularly VoIP providers. VoIP services rely on internet connectivity and may not be able to accurately route emergency calls to the appropriate Public Safety Answering Point (PSAP) in Canada. Furthermore, location information may not be readily available for VoIP calls originating from outside the country. Individuals relying on international VoIP services should verify the availability of emergency calling capabilities and understand the associated limitations.
